WebWhat is the difference between a logophile or a lexophile? Both words include the Greek word “philia” which means love or affection. The logo part of logophile comes from the Greek word logos which means "word."; The lexo in lexophile comes from the Greek word lexikos which means “of words.”; The difference between these two words is very subtle.
